Jordan unveils 2007 Clio livery
Andrew Jordan has unveiled the livery for his challenge in the Elf Renault Clio Cup with Team Eurotech.The Clio ran in its John Guest Speedfit livery for the first time during testing at Oulton Park last week as Andrew progresses his pre-season testing programme.The Oulton Park test was the sixth day of running in a comprehensive 12-day schedule, which will be completed ahead of the testing restrictions that come into effect in early March.Through the pre-season test programme and during the coming season, former BTCC champion Chris Hodgetts will be coaching the 17-year old. The 1986 and 1987 BTCC champion is bringing more than three decades of racing experience to the project.Meanwhile, Andrew's father Mike gave his Team Eurotech Honda Integra a shakedown test at Snetterton on Saturday (17 February). Following a total rebuild, this was the car's first test of the season and Mike will now crank up his pre-season BTCC test programme.Andrew Jordan is supported by John Guest, Pirtek and Bill Gwynne Rally School.
